Over a five-year period, European NATO countries have witnessed a more than doubling of their arms imports, with the United States being the primary source for 60 percent of these imports, according to a report published by a prominent conflict think tank on Monday. Ukraine has surged to the top position as the world’s leading arms importer, while the United States has further solidified its standing as the world’s number one arms exporter, now responsible for 43 percent of all global arms exports.
